sys.dm_os_cluster_nodes (SQL Bertransaksi)

Berlaku untuk:yes SQL Server (semua versi yang didukung) yesAzure Synapse Analytics Analytics yesPlatform System (PDW)

Mengembalikan satu baris untuk setiap simpul dalam konfigurasi instans kluster failover. Jika instans saat ini adalah instans terkluster failover, instans tersebut mengembalikan daftar simpul tempat instans kluster failover ini (sebelumnya "server virtual") telah ditentukan. Jika instans server saat ini bukan instans terkluster failover, instans tersebut mengembalikan set baris kosong.

CATATAN: Untuk memanggil ini dari Azure Synapse Analytics atau Analytics Platform System (PDW), gunakan nama sys.dm_pdw_nodes_os_cluster_nodes. Sintaks ini tidak didukung oleh kumpulan SQL tanpa server di Azure Synapse Analytics.

Nama kolom Jenis data Deskripsi
NodeName nama sysname Nama simpul dalam konfigurasi instans kluster failover (server virtual) SQL Server.
status int Status simpul dalam instans kluster failover SQL Server: 0, 1, 2, 3, -1. Untuk informasi selengkapnya, lihat Fungsi GetClusterNodeState.
status_description nvarchar(20) Deskripsi status node kluster failover SQL Server.

0 = naik

1 = turun

2 = dijeda

3 = bergabung

-1 = tidak diketahui
is_current_owner bit 1 berarti simpul ini adalah pemilik sumber daya kluster failover SQL Server saat ini.
pdw_node_id int Berlaku untuk: Azure Synapse Analytics, Analytics Platform System (PDW)

Pengidentifikasi untuk simpul tempat distribusi ini aktif.

Keterangan

Ketika pengklusteran failover diaktifkan, instans SQL Server dapat berjalan pada salah satu node kluster failover yang ditetapkan sebagai bagian dari konfigurasi instans kluster failover (server virtual) SQL Server.

CATATAN: Tampilan ini menggantikan fungsi fn_virtualservernodes, yang tidak akan digunakan lagi dalam rilis mendatang.

Izin

Memerlukan izin LIHAT STATUS SERVER pada instans SQL Server.

Contoh

Contoh berikut menggunakan sys. dm_os_cluster_nodes untuk mengembalikan simpul pada instans server berkluster.

SELECT NodeName, status, status_description, is_current_owner   
FROM sys.dm_os_cluster_nodes;  

Berikut adalah hasil yang ditetapkan.

NodeName status status_description is_current_owner
node1 0 naik 1
node2 0 naik 0
Node3 1 Turun 0

Lihat juga

sys.dm_os_cluster_properties (SQL Bertransaksi)
sys.dm_io_cluster_shared_drives (SQL bertransaksi)
sys.fn_virtualservernodes (SQL Bertransaksi)
Tampilan dan Fungsi Manajemen Dinamis (SQL Bertransaksi)